考虑线性不确定系统的鲁棒镇定问题,系统的不确定性由参数摄动和附加扰动组成.系统的参数摄动采用凸边界系统族的方法描述,给出了该系统可鲁棒δ镇定的一个充分条件,基于这个结果将不确定系统的鲁棒δ镇定问题转化为一个优化问题,并且进一步证明了该优化问题是凸的,因此其任何一个局部最优点也是全局最优点.算例说明了该方法的有效性.
Considering the robust stabilization of linear uncertain systems, the system uncertainties consist of parameter perturbations and additional perturbations. The parameter perturbation of the system is described by the convex boundary system family method. A sufficient condition for the system to be robust δstability is given. Based on this result, the robust δstabilization problem of uncertain systems is transformed into an optimization problem. And further proves that the optimization problem is convex, so any one local optimal point is also the global optimal point. The example shows the effectiveness of this method.
